Zener-Protected SuperMESH3 Power MOSFETs

STMicroelectronics Zener-Protected SuperMESH3™ Power MOSFETs are created through increased fine-tuning of STMicroelectronic's strip-based PowerMESH™ layout, combined with optimization of the vertical structure. In addition to significantly reducing ON-resistance, special attention has been taken to ensure these MOSFETs offer dynamic performance with a large avalanche capability. STMicroelectronics Zener-Protected SuperMESH3 Power MOSFETs are offered in voltages up to 1200V. Applications include switch-mode low-power supplies (SMPS), DC-DC converters, switching, and offline power supplies.
